Transaction 51885ec5a69a4acb89a861e24762711b10faadacad566af4c8c2d533939b5ef2

1 Input
2 Outputs
  • 51885ec5a69a4acb89a861e24762711b10faadacad566af4c8c2d533939b5ef2:0
  • value  13433210591
    address  1JbZGCL2cLmAirLUCdz973gRmfUV76cLRZ
  • 51885ec5a69a4acb89a861e24762711b10faadacad566af4c8c2d533939b5ef2:1
  • value  13423053
    address  136xM1TL7eVGT1gZCqxP2HLBxnFKmDajkr